Matters to be negotiated Sample Clauses

Matters to be negotiated. The matters relating to the terms of employment that the Ministry will negotiate with the new employer will be those set out in this written contract of employment and, for the avoidance of doubt, will not include any matters contained in Ministry policies or any other discretionary benefits of employment.

Matters to be negotiated. The matters relating to the terms and conditions of employment that Oranga Tamariki will negotiate with the new employer will be those set out in this written contract of employment and, for the avoidance of doubt, will not include any matters contained in Oranga Tamariki policies or any other discretionary benefits of employment.
Matters to be negotiated. The process for discussing and negotiating these matters will include a meeting between ACC and the new employer. Such a meeting will occur during the restructure negotiations, prior to any decisions being made. As part of the process, affected employees and their unions will be advised of such a meeting within a reasonable time frame prior to the meeting taking place. At this time, information regarding the attendees, agenda and the method the parties anticipate using to reach an agreement will be made available to the affected employees and their union. Following the meeting, ACC will report back to the affected employees and their union, sharing the outcome of the meeting that relates to the affected employees. Throughout this process, ACC will endeavour to comply with their statutory obligations of good faith and consultation.

  • PROCEDURES FOR ADDRESSING UNAUTHORIZED TRANSACTIONS AND OTHER TRANSACTION PROBLEMS In the event of a problem with a Debit Card transaction, or unauthorized Debit Card transaction, other than a matter related to goods or services provided by Merchants, I will report the issue promptly to my Credit Union and the Credit Union will investigate and respond to the issue on a timely basis. My Credit Union will not unreasonably restrict me from the use of any funds subject to dispute, if it is reasonably evident that I did not contribute to the problem or unauthorized transaction. My Credit Union will respond to my report of a problem or unauthorized transaction within 10 business days and will indicate what reimbursement, if any, will be made for any loss incurred by me. Reimbursement will be made for losses from a problem or unauthorized use in this time frame if it is evident that I did not contribute knowingly to the problem or unauthorized transaction and that I took reasonable steps to protect the confidentiality of my PIN or Passcode. An extension of the 10-day limit may be necessary if my Credit Union requires me to provide a written statement or affidavit to aid its investigation.
